OPERATION CHECK
- DAYTIME RUNNING LIGHT OPERATION CHECK Turn the light control switch off. Start the engine. Release the parking brake. Check that the daytime running lights (dimmed high beam headlights) come on.
DESCRIPTION
- The daytime running light relay receives the light control switch HEAD signal and the ambient light level signal from the automatic light control sensor to control the headlight relay. HINT: If only a low beam headlight bulb on one side does not illuminate, inspect the bulb, fuse, or wire harness related to the bulb.

- INSPECT FUSE (H-LP MAIN) Remove the H-LP MAIN fuse from the engine room relay block. Measure the resistance according to the value(s) in the table below. Standard Resistance Tester Connection Condition Specified Condition H-LP MAIN fuse Always Below 1 ohms NG --> REPLACE FUSE OK: Go to next step
- INSPECT ENGINE ROOM RELAY BLOCK Install the H-LP MAIN fuse to the engine room relay block. Remove the H-LP LH LO fuse and H-LP RH LO fuse from the engine room relay block. Measure the voltage between the loading slot of each fuse and body ground. Standard Voltage Tester Connection Switch Condition Specified Condition H-LP LH LO fuse terminal - Body ground Light control switch OFF --> HEAD Below 1 V --> 11 to 14 V H-LP RH LO fuse terminal - Body ground Light control switch OFF --> HEAD Below 1 V --> 11 to 14 V NG --> See step 3 OK --> REPAIR OR REPLACE HARNESS OR CONNECTOR (FUSE - BODY GROUND)
- INSPECT HEADLIGHT RELAY (H-LP) Remove the headlight relay from the engine room relay block. Measure the resistance according to the value(s) in the table below. Standard Resistance Tester Connection Condition Specified Condition 3 - 5 Voltage is not applied between terminals 1 and 2 10 kohms or higher 3 - 5 Voltage is applied between terminals 1 and 2 Below 1 ohms NG --> REPLACE HEADLIGHT RELAY OK: Go to next step
- CHECK HARNESS AND CONNECTOR (BATTERY - HEADLIGHT RELAY) Measure the voltage on the relay block side according to the value(s) in the table below. Standard Voltage Tester Connection Condition Specified Condition Headlight relay terminal 5 - Body ground Always 11 to 14 V Headlight relay terminal 1 - Body ground Always 11 to 14 V NG --> REPAIR OR REPLACE HARNESS OR CONNECTOR OK: Go to next step
- CHECK HARNESS AND CONNECTOR (HEADLIGHT RELAY - FUSE) Measure the resistance according to the value(s) in the table below. Standard Resistance Tester Connection Condition Specified Condition Headlight relay terminal 3 - H-LP LH LO fuse terminal Always Below 1 ohms Headlight relay terminal 3 - H-LP RH LO fuse terminal Always Below 1 ohms NG --> REPAIR OR REPLACE HARNESS OR CONNECTOR OK: Go to next step
- CHECK HARNESS AND CONNECTOR (HEADLIGHT RELAY - DAYTIME RUNNING LIGHT RELAY) Disconnect the E91 daytime running light relay connector. Measure the resistance according to the value(s) in the table below. Standard Resistance Tester Connection Condition Specified Condition Headlight relay terminal 2 - E91-4 (H-LP) Always Below 1 ohms E91-4 (H-LP) - Body ground Always 10 kohms or higher NG --> REPAIR OR REPLACE HARNESS OR CONNECTOR OK --> See step 7
- PROCEED TO NEXT CIRCUIT INSPECTION SHOWN IN PROBLEM SYMPTOMS TABLE. Refer to «PROBLEM SYMPTOMS TABLE»(ref-426115-S32738808192011101200000)
- When both of the following conditions are met, the high beam headlights will come on. Low beam headlights are turned on by the automatic light control or manual light control. Dimmer switch is in HIGH position.
- The daytime running light relay dims the high beam headlights when operating them as daytime running lights.
- When the dimmer switch is turned to the HIGH FLASH position, the high beam headlights will come on. HINT: If only a high beam headlight on one side does not illuminate, inspect the fuse, bulb, or wire harness that is related to the bulb. Before performing troubleshooting of the high beam headlight control, check that the low beam headlight operates normally.

- INSPECT HEADLIGHT DIMMER RELAY (DIM) Remove the headlight dimmer relay from the engine room relay block. Measure the resistance according to the value(s) in the table below. Standard Resistance Tester Connection Condition Specified Condition 3 - 5 Voltage is not applied between terminals 1 and 2 10 kohms or higher 3 - 5 Voltage is applied between terminals 1 and 2 Below 1 ohms NG --> REPLACE HEADLIGHT DIMMER RELAY OK: Go to next step
- CHECK HARNESS AND CONNECTOR (BATTERY - HEADLIGHT DIMMER RELAY) Measure the voltage according to the value(s) in the table below. Standard Voltage Tester Connection Condition Specified Condition Headlight dimmer relay terminal 2 - Body ground Always 11 to 14 V Headlight dimmer relay terminal 3 - Body ground Always 11 to 14 V NG --> REPAIR OR REPLACE HARNESS OR CONNECTOR OK: Go to next step
- CHECK HARNESS AND CONNECTOR (HEADLIGHT DIMMER RELAY - DAYTIME RUNNING LIGHT RELAY) Disconnect the E91 daytime running light relay connector. Measure the resistance according to the value(s) in the table below. Standard Resistance Tester Connection Condition Specified Condition Headlight dimmer relay terminal 1 - E91-13 (DIM) Always Below 1 ohms E91-13 (DIM) - Body ground Always 10 kohms or higher NG --> REPAIR OR REPLACE HARNESS OR CONNECTOR OK: Go to next step
- CHECK HARNESS AND CONNECTOR (HEADLIGHT DIMMER RELAY - HEADLIGHT ASSEMBLY) Disconnect the A38 headlight assembly LH and A37 headlight assembly RH connector. Measure the resistance according to the value(s) in the table below. Standard Resistance Tester Connection Condition Specified Condition Headlight dimmer relay terminal 5 - A38-1 Always Below 1 ohms Headlight dimmer relay terminal 5 - Body ground Always 10 kohms or higher Headlight dimmer relay terminal 5 - A37-1 Always Below 1 ohms Headlight dimmer relay terminal 5 - Body ground Always 10 kohms or higher NG --> REPAIR OR REPLACE HARNESS OR CONNECTOR OK: Go to next step
- CHECK HARNESS AND CONNECTOR (HEADLIGHT ASSEMBLY - DAYTIME RUNNING LIGHT RELAY) Disconnect the E91 daytime running light relay connector. Measure the resistance according to the value(s) in the table below. Standard Resistance Tester Connection Condition Specified Condition A38-2 - E91-10 (DRL) Always Below 1 ohms A38-2 - Body ground Always 10 kohms or higher A37-2 - E91-10 (DRL) Always Below 1 ohms A37-2 - Body ground Always 10 kohms or higher NG --> REPAIR OR REPLACE HARNESS OR CONNECTOR OK --> See step 6

- CHECK HARNESS AND CONNECTOR (DAYTIME RUNNING LIGHT RELAY - BODY GROUND) Disconnect the E91 daytime running light relay connector. Measure the resistance according to the value(s) in the table below. Standard Resistance Tester connection Condition Specified condition E91-9 (PKB) - Body ground Parking brake is released 10 kohms or higher E91-9 (PKB) - Body ground Parking brake is applied Below 1 ohms NG --> See step 2 OK --> See step 3
- INSPECT PARKING BRAKE SWITCH ASSEMBLY Remove the parking brake switch assembly. Measure the resistance according to the value(s) in the table below. Standard Resistance Tester connection Condition Specified resistance 1 - Switch body OFF (When shaft is pressed) 10 kohms or higher 1 - Switch body ON (When shaft is not pressed) Below 1 ohms NG --> See step 4 OK --> REPAIR OR REPLACE HARNESS OR CONNECTOR (PARKING BRAKE SWITCH CIRCUIT)

- The daytime running light relay receives the light control switch TAIL signal to control the taillight relay.
HINT
- If only one taillight does not illuminate, check the bulb or wire harness related to the bulb.
- The taillight relay is installed in the instrument panel junction block, so unlike conventional relays, it can not be removed for inspection.
